The latest addition to the 'Saw' franchise is already terrifying people and it's only been in theatres for a day. While chatting in a new NME interview, 'Saw X' director Kevin Greutert shared an encounter with law enforcement while editing the upcoming slasher-torture flick. While assistant editor Steve Forn was editing the gruesome movie, neighbours heard so much screaming that they believed someone was in danger and desperately needed help. “There was a knock at the door,” Greutert remembered. “We have the doorbell [camera] video of the police walking up, [Forn answering the door] and the police saying, ‘The neighbors [have been] calling and saying someone’s being tortured to death in here.”“And he [Forn] was like, ‘Actually, I’m just working on a movie… You can come in and see it if you want?’ The cops started laughing! They said, ‘We want to but, you know, you’re all right.
